Ingredients
Quantity | Ingredient |
---|---|
1 | Salmon fillet |
1 | Pepper (to taste) |
1/4 | Milk |
1/2 | Dill dip (prepared) |
2 | Tablespoons of oil (for brushing) |
Instructions
-
Prepare the Grill
Begin by heating your coals or gas grill to achieve direct heat. This method ensures that the salmon cooks evenly while allowing it to absorb the smoky flavors that come from grilling. -
Prepare the Salmon
Lay a 24-inch piece of heavy-duty aluminum foil on a clean surface. Place the salmon fillet in the center of the foil. Using a brush, apply a generous amount of oil over the salmon, which will help keep it moist during grilling. Season the fish liberally with freshly cracked pepper, ensuring each bite will be flavorful. Carefully wrap the foil around the fish, making sure it is sealed tightly to trap in all the moisture and flavor. -
Grill the Salmon
Once your grill has reached the ideal temperature, place the foil-wrapped salmon on the grill, positioning it about 4 to 6 inches away from the medium heat source. Close the grill lid and allow the salmon to cook for approximately 20 to 30 minutes. The cooking time may vary slightly depending on the thickness of the salmon fillet. Youโll know itโs done when the fish flakes easily with a fork, indicating it has reached the perfect level of doneness. -
Prepare the Dill Sauce
While the salmon is grilling, take a moment to prepare the accompanying dill sauce. In a small mixing bowl, combine the prepared dill dip with the milk. Stir the mixture until it becomes smooth and creamy. This dill sauce will add a refreshing contrast to the rich flavors of the grilled salmon. -
Serve
Once the salmon is fully cooked, carefully unwrap the foil to avoid steam burns. Serve the grilled salmon hot, drizzled with the freshly prepared dill sauce. This dish pairs wonderfully with a side of steamed vegetables or a light salad, enhancing the overall dining experience.
